## Releases

Heads up, on-call: v1.9.3 of Snapcrate fixes the image-cache leak that was slowly eating heap on long-lived workers — evicted entries now actually release their buffers. If memory climbs past the old pattern, roll back and ping the Ferrow team. Release tarballs are signed before upload; verify each one against the current release key below.

rollout seal: bky4_x7Gc

CI note for newcomers: the cold-archive job for Tundrabyte buckets only runs on the nightly lane, so don't panic if your PR pipeline skips it. If it fails, it's almost always a stale manifest — rerun with `--refresh-manifest`. Check the failing run against the token that appears below.

session token of yajof-bagef = htk4_937d

Subject: Handover — Atlaspane tile cache

Welcome aboard. The Atlaspane tile-rendering cache sits between the renderer fleet and the style service. Releases go out Tuesdays; always purge the edge tier after schema bumps, otherwise stale tiles linger for hours. Staging mirrors prod config except for TTLs. Signed artifacts are mandatory, so add the deploy key below to your agent before your first push.

signing key of bagap-yawep = bky13_TbfT6ZMUoGJo2

Subject: Handover — Larkspur SFTP drop

Hey future release folks — quick handover note. The weekly export to our partner Velmore lands via their SFTP drop every Thursday night; if the push fails, just rerun the uploader job, it's idempotent. One gotcha: the drop rejects unsigned bundles. The deploy key you need is right below.

release key, kaweg-yawif: bky6_xXFRJ1

If your plugin hooks into the Lanternsite incremental rebuild pipeline, note that only pages whose content hash changed are re-rendered. Plugins that read global state must declare it in their manifest, or stale output will ship. Rebuilds are triggered per-commit and batched every two minutes. Cache invalidation is automatic for declared dependencies; undeclared ones are your problem. Test against the staging builder before publishing. The full dependency-declaration spec and builder API reference are documented on our internal page:

dashboard of kafof-tahaf = https://confluence.tolvaqsys.internal/projects/browse/display/a1250987